  • I've been attending First Church for almost five years now, and I have to say that this is a wonderful church. I was looking for a place that practices what they preach - love everyone, period. "Open Hearts, Open Minds, Open Doors" is more than just a cute motto. Everyone is truly welcome.

    The pastor is a truly gifted speaker, and the the ministry leaders are a group of very warm and caring people. They make the Church (not just the building, but the organization as a whole) a place where you'd like to stay. I've also found that many of the congregation members are just as welcoming and caring - a theme that seems to work its way through everything going on at the church.

    If you are looking for a place to find some peace, or looking for a church to call home, I wholeheartedly suggest coming in for a few weeks to check it out. The beautiful music alone will make it worth your while!

  • I must say my experience of this church was for many years the exact opposite of what the two star review relates. I joined here a number of years ago and left Pittsburgh for work-related purposes a few years after that. While it is possible to catch the church on an off day perhaps when a visiting pastor is in the pulpit or the choir is trying something new, the experience of always being welcome regardless of age, race, sex, gender, or sexual orientation and being able to enter a worship service that for those who attend simply works characterized most, if not all, Sundays for me. In Methodist fashion, communion always had a literal component to it--it's the rare church that embraces silence in its liturgy and prayers and First Church gets it right on all accounts.

    The part about not leaving for lunch by noon is true but I was always full when it was time to leave. I miss this church deeply.

    This church, its clergy, and members literally changed my life for the better. Come and see!

    They're probably pretty good people - interested in feeding the hungry, missions work, that sort of stuff. So don't take this review too seriously. The service was like one of those really boring services you see in movies, where everyone is there just to be able to pat themselves on the back for being such a good person for going to church. The lyrics to the choir's song - I kid you not - consisted of one word: "Alleluia" repeated a bazillion times. The sermon sounded like a bunch of inspiring words strung together by a screenwriter instead of an actual Christian. It reminded me of the kinds of "prayers" they pray in Congress - totally devoid of any actual relationship with God. And don't plan on leaving for lunch by noon.
